Transaction 662ccf89cc4bb98cd4c5ca3ba1decb7031cecca726a40ab7cfd4c41d3598fc10
1 Input
1 Output
-
662ccf89cc4bb98cd4c5ca3ba1decb7031cecca726a40ab7cfd4c41d3598fc10:0
- value
- 2613678
- script pubkey
- OP_0 OP_PUSHBYTES_20 6fa8b9c517860624f647cc87c0740b8930dad275
- address
- bc1qd75tn3ghscrzfaj8ejruqaqt3ycd45n43gqdpc